Emergency Landing: Flight Returns to Logan Airport After Lightning Strike

A dramatic turn of events unfolded at Logan International Airport when a commercial flight was forced to make an emergency landing after being struck by lightning shortly after takeoff. The incident, which occurred on a typically routine journey, highlights the unpredictable nature of air travel and the quick response of aviation professionals in ensuring passenger safety.

The Incident

On a clear afternoon, a flight departing from Logan International Airport bound for a domestic destination encountered a severe thunderstorm shortly after takeoff. As the aircraft climbed to cruising altitude, it was struck by lightning, causing a loud bang and momentary loss of power. Passengers reported seeing a bright flash and feeling the plane shudder, sparking immediate concern.

Crew Response

The flight crew, trained for such emergencies, quickly assessed the situation. Following standard safety protocols, the captain decided to return to Logan Airport as a precautionary measure. The crew informed passengers of the situation, reassuring them that they were taking necessary steps to ensure their safety. Air traffic control was promptly notified, and preparations for an emergency landing were set in motion.

Safe Landing and Evacuation

Thanks to the swift actions of the flight crew and ground control, the aircraft made a safe landing back at Logan Airport. Emergency services were on standby, ready to assist if needed. Upon landing, the plane was thoroughly inspected for any damage. Passengers were safely disembarked and escorted to the terminal, where they were provided with updates and assistance from airline staff.

Passenger Reactions

While the experience was undoubtedly unsettling, passengers expressed gratitude for the professionalism and calm demeanor of the flight crew. "It was scary at first, but the crew handled it really well and kept us informed," one passenger remarked. Many praised the airline for prioritizing safety and acting swiftly to address the emergency.

Expert Insights

Aviation experts highlight that lightning strikes on aircraft, while alarming, are relatively common and usually not dangerous due to the design and construction of modern planes. Aircraft are built to withstand lightning strikes, with safety features that dissipate electrical energy and protect critical systems. This incident underscores the importance of rigorous training and preparedness for airline crews in handling such situations.

Airline Response

The airline involved issued a statement commending the flight crew for their quick thinking and professionalism. They assured passengers that safety is their top priority and that the aircraft would undergo a thorough inspection before returning to service. The airline also extended apologies for any inconvenience caused and offered support to affected passengers, including rebooking on subsequent flights.
